Hungary and the Carpathian Basin: A Natural Geothermal Hub

The unique geological position of Hungary and the wider Carpathian Basin makes the region particularly well-suited for geothermal development. With shallow geothermal gradients and a long history of thermal water use, Hungary is already home to thousands of geothermal wells — many used in balneology, agriculture, and heating.

This makes Budapest the ideal host city for a pan-regional geothermal summit. By leveraging local success stories and resource availability, the summit is able to highlight Hungary's potential as both a user and exporter of geothermal knowledge, services, and technologies.

Key geological advantages of the region:

High geothermal gradient allows for cost-efficient drilling

Accessible hot water aquifers beneath urban areas

Proximity to EU energy markets and funding frameworks

Abundant potential for both direct use and electricity generation

This natural positioning, combined with supportive policy signals, makes the CEE region ripe for geothermal investment — a theme thoroughly explored throughout the Summit.

Why Hydropower Matters More Than Ever

Hydropower accounts for nearly 60% of Canada’s electricity generation, making it a cornerstone of national energy infrastructure. But beyond the numbers, waterpower provides critical benefits that extend well beyond the grid.

Hydropower’s broader impact includes:

   Economic Growth: Sustaining thousands of jobs in construction, operation, and research

   Energy Security: Providing stable, dispatchable baseload power for a resilient grid

   Climate Action: Supporting Canada's leadership in reducing carbon emissions

   Regional Development: Driving economic activity in rural and Indigenous communities

   Innovation Leadership: Fueling global best practices in clean power development

As the energy sector moves toward electrification and decarbonization, hydropower’s unique attributes—renewability, reliability, and storability—make it an irreplaceable part of the solution.

The Role of Renewable Energy in Canada’s Grid Transformation

Canada’s energy infrastructure is undergoing a fundamental transformation. The demand for clean electricity is rising sharply, driven by decarbonization goals, electric vehicle adoption, and the electrification of heating and industrial processes. This transition requires not just more generation capacity—but smarter, more resilient, and flexible power systems.

Electricity Transformation Canada places a spotlight on the technologies at the heart of this transition:

Wind energy: As one of Canada’s fastest-growing renewable sources, wind offers scalable, low-cost electricity generation.

Solar energy: From rooftop panels to utility-scale PV farms, solar is vital for daytime peak loads and decentralization.

Energy storage: The bridge between generation and demand, storage systems provide essential grid stability and backup during periods of variability.

Together, these technologies are reshaping Canada’s electricity sector and forming the foundation of a low-carbon energy economy.
